s390x/cpumodel: Add missing visit_free

Beata Michalska noticed this missing visit_free() while reviewing
arm's implementation of qmp_query_cpu_model_expansion(), which is
modeled off this s390x implementation.

Signed-off-by: Andrew Jones <drjones@redhat.com>
Message-Id: <20191016145434.7007-1-drjones@redhat.com>
Reviewed-by: David Hildenbrand <david@redhat.com>
Signed-off-by: Cornelia Huck <cohuck@redhat.com>
This commit is contained in:
Andrew Jones 2019-10-16 16:54:34 +02:00 committed by Cornelia Huck
parent e9d4246192
commit be39110d4c

View File

@ -515,6 +515,7 @@ static void cpu_model_from_info(S390CPUModel *model, const CpuModelInfo *info,
visitor = qobject_input_visitor_new(info->props);
visit_start_struct(visitor, NULL, NULL, 0, errp);
if (*errp) {
visit_free(visitor);
object_unref(obj);
return;
}